(New York, NY - September 27, 2004) Healthcare and business
marketing professional Susan C. Mantel has been named
Executive Director of Joan’s Legacy: The Joan
Scarangello Foundation to Conquer Lung Cancer.
Joan’s Legacy is named
for Joan Scarangello, a writer and nonsmoker who died
at age 47 after a valiant nine-month fight with lung
cancer. Joan’s Legacy is committed to fighting
lung cancer by searching for a cure and focusing greater
attention on the world’s leading cancer killer.
Funding $700,000 in new and cutting-edge research in
less than three years, Joan’s Legacy is fast becoming
the “venture capital” source for lung cancer
research.
As Executive Director, Ms.
Mantel will work with the Board of Directors to execute
the Foundation’s development and growth initiatives.
She will also help Joan’s Legacy collaborate with
like-minded organizations across the country to achieve
the common goal of finding a cure for the disease that
will take the lives of 160,000 Americans this year.
Prior to joining Joan’s
Legacy, Ms. Mantel served as a Senior Marketing Manager
for Pfizer, Inc., where she executed initiatives to
introduce new products and instituted a number of educational
and training programs for physicians as well as Pfizer’s
sales force. Previously, Ms. Mantel served as Worldwide
Health Care Practice Coordinator for The Boston Consulting
Group.
Ms. Mantel has been actively
involved with not-for-profit organizations for many
years. As an independent consultant, board member and
volunteer, she has made important contributions for
organizations including Action Against Hunger, Mustard
Seed Communities, and New York Cares’ Read-to-Me
Program.
Ms. Mantel holds an MBA from
the Kellogg School of Management at Northwestern University
and a BA from Haverford College. She resides in Manhattan.
